> I'm not quite that doctrinaire :-)  but given the usage, I think it
> is best to be clear, as you say.  There's a lot of this generic
> naming around; imagine if you wanted to write a hypertext
> markup language....

Clarity it is.  I thought of GenericMarkupLanguageDomLikeStructureGenerator,
but that just doesn't roll off the tongue.  So, it's MLTagParser, and
version 0.2 is now available.

Jimmy